Here are the answers to Witches Quiz #1…

1. ‘Hecate’ The Queen of the witches appears in which Shakespeare play?

A. Macbeth


2. Easter witches can be found in which two European countries?

A. Finland & Sweden


3. In which decade was the last person tried for witchcraft in Scotland?

A. 1940’s (1944)


4. Ursula the sea witch, features in which film?

A. The Little Mermaid


5. What is the collective noun for a group of witches?

A. A Coven


6. The film ‘The Witches’, released in 1990, was based on a book by which author?

A. Roald Dahl


7. In which US town were witches hanged on ‘Gallows Hill’?

A. Salem


8. Who wrote ‘The Worst Witch’ series of books?

A. Jill Murphy


9. Which word from old English, means ‘female sorceress’?

A. Wicce


10. Who played everyone’s favourite witch Winifred Sanderson in the 1993 film ‘Hocus Pocus’?

A. Bette Midler
